Which city did the first regular radio broadcasts take place?

The first regular radio broadcasts took place in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ania. This milestone was achieved by KDKA, which began broadcasting on November 2, 1920. KDKA is often credited as the world's first commercial radio station, marking the beginning of regular radio transmission and programming for the public.

In which decade did the first American radio stations start?

Various hobbyists and electrical nerds were transmitting music and talk, occasionally, without firm schedules, for the entertainment of their neighbors, during the 19-teens. The first commercially licensed radio station in the USA is widely considered to have been KDKA in Pittsburgh, which began scheduled operation in November of 1920.

What were radio facts?

The first radio station was NOT Pittsburgh's KDKA, although it was certainly an important early station. Commercial radio began in 1920, and probably 8MK (later known as WWJ) in Detroit was the first, going on the air in August of 1920, while KDKA went on the air in late October. Early radio did not have commercial advertising. Most stations were only on the air a couple of hours a night in those early days. In the first year of radio, there were perhaps ten stations. But by 1922, the radio craze was exploding all over the US, as several hundred stations went on the air. Commercial advertising didn't become common till the mid-1920s. Some stations aired news reports as early as 1921-1922. Most radio broadcasts in the 1920s featured live performers, as tape had not yet been invented. Some stations played phonograph records, but most used live and local talent. The first national radio network was NBC (National Broadcasting Company), which began in late 1926.
